The Monastery of St. George Hozevita is considered one of the most beautiful similar structures built in the Holy Land.   The most convenient way to get here is along the road connecting Jericho and Jerusalem.

The monastery is located in a rocky area, on the territory of the Wadi Kelt gorge. It was founded at the end of the 5th century AD and named after the successor of St. John – George. George Hozevit was buried on the territory of the monastery. The monks who lived here lived in cave cells and were hermits. In 1187 the monastery was destroyed and was abandoned for many centuries.

In 1878, the monk Kalinnik settled here, who arrived from Greece, who began to conduct archaeological excavations. Already in 1901, the monastery was reconstructed and restored by the efforts of the Greek Orthodox Patriarchate of Jerusalem. And in 1952 a bell tower was built here, harmoniously complementing the monastery complex. Currently, the monastery is visited by many tourists who want to learn more about the history of the country.
